编程语言
首页 > 编程语言> > 如何在不使用命名空间的情况下在PHP中使用相同的命名类?

如何在不使用命名空间的情况下在PHP中使用相同的命名类?

作者:互联网

我有一个问题,我必须同时扩展和使用两个第三方库类.但是两者都具有相同的命名约定,并且两个类名最终具有相同的名称.

由于我不能扩展两个类,所以我不知道如何解决它们,也不知道如何针对一个创建包装器.我不能使用PHP命名空间,因为PHP版本仅为5.2.10,而不是5.3.

我有什么选择?

解决方法:

我认为您可以为一类实现类似rpc的接口.对于其他,您可以扩展和使用.
http://en.wikipedia.org/wiki/Remote_procedure_call

标签:namespaces,naming,php,class
来源: https://codeday.me/bug/20191209/2095908.html